After flying high against Calhoun County on Tuesday, Pataula Charter Academy came back down to earth. The Pataula Charter Academy Panthers lost 13-1 to the Cairo Syrupmakers on Wednesday.
Having lost for the first time this season, Pataula Charter Academy fell to 2-1. As for Cairo, the victory got them back to even at 2-2.
Pataula Charter Academy will be playing at home against Southwest Georgia STEM Charter at 6:00 p.m. on Thursday. Pataula Charter Academy will be looking to keep their five-game home win streak dating back to last season alive. As for Cairo, they will head out on the road to square off against Thomas County Central at 5:00 p.m. on Monday.
